Bootstrap框架是一个全面评测构建响应式网站的最佳选择。它提供了丰富的组件和样式,使网站能够适应不同设备和屏幕尺寸。通过使用Bootstrap,开发者可以轻松地创建出具有良好用户体验的网站。Bootstrap还具备良好的兼容性和可扩展性,使得网站开发更加高效和便捷。对于想要构建响应式网站的开发者来说,Bootstrap框架是一个非常值得考虑的选择。
在当今的互联网世界里,网站的设计和开发已经成为一项至关重要的技能,为了提高开发效率和降低开发难度,许多开发者选择了使用前端框架,而在众多前端框架中,Bootstrap无疑是最受欢迎的一个,Bootstrap究竟有哪些优点和缺点?它是否真的是构建响应式网站的最佳选择?本文将为您进行全面评测。
我们来了解一下Bootstrap框架的基本概念,Bootstrap是一个开源的前端框架,由Twitter公司推出,旨在帮助开发者快速构建响应式、移动优先的网站,Bootstrap提供了一套丰富的CSS和JavaScript组件,以及一个用于快速构建布局的网格系统,通过使用Bootstrap,开发者可以快速实现网站的响应式设计,适应不同设备的屏幕尺寸。
我们将从以下几个方面对Bootstrap框架进行评测:
1、文档和社区支持
Bootstrap的官方文档非常详细,涵盖了框架的所有功能和组件,Bootstrap还拥有庞大的社区支持,开发者可以在GitHub、Stack Overflow等平台上找到大量的教程、示例和解决方案,这使得学习和使用Bootstrap变得相对容易。
2、响应式设计
Bootstrap的响应式设计是其最大的优点之一,通过使用Bootstrap的网格系统,开发者可以轻松地实现网站的自适应布局,适应各种设备和屏幕尺寸,Bootstrap还提供了一些预定义的类,如.container
、.row
和.col
,用于快速创建响应式布局,这使得开发者可以专注于内容和功能的实现,而无需过多关注样式和布局。
3、组件库
Bootstrap提供了一套丰富的组件库,包括导航栏、轮播图、弹出框、下拉菜单等,这些组件已经经过充分测试,兼容性良好,可以直接使用或进行定制,这使得开发者可以快速构建出具有专业感的网站界面。
4、JavaScript插件
除了CSS组件外,Bootstrap还提供了一些实用的JavaScript插件,如模态框、滚动监听、提示框等,这些插件可以帮助开发者实现更丰富的交互效果,提高用户体验,需要注意的是,部分插件依赖于jQuery库,因此在使用时需要确保已正确引入jQuery。
5、性能
虽然Bootstrap的组件和插件可以提高开发效率,但它们也可能导致网站加载速度变慢,这是因为Bootstrap包含了大量预定义的样式和脚本,而这些样式和脚本可能并不适用于所有的网站项目,在使用Bootstrap时,开发者需要注意对组件和插件进行按需加载,以减少不必要的资源消耗。
6、定制化
虽然Bootstrap提供了丰富的组件和样式,但由于其通用性,有时可能无法满足特定项目的需求,在这种情况下,开发者需要进行一定程度的定制化,由于Bootstrap的样式和组件相互依赖,定制化过程可能会比较繁琐,在使用Bootstrap时,开发者需要权衡定制化的需求和开发效率。
Bootstrap框架凭借其丰富的组件库、响应式设计和强大的社区支持,成为了构建响应式网站的首选框架,在使用Bootstrap时,开发者需要注意性能和定制化的问题,以确保网站的性能和用户体验,Bootstrap是一个非常值得学习和使用的前端框架。